Impulse Gamer: Star Raiders Review

Impulse Gamer: Star Raiders is Published by Atari Europe and Developed by Incinerator Studios. As most of us know, Star Raiders is an old title from the late 1970’s. This game started the inspiration for future space combat titles and could be considered an archetype. Having Atari bring back a name like this will definitely cause some curiosity, especially those gamers who have played the original.

Read Full Story >>
The story is too old to be commented.